This testing apparatus is readily available from contractor's tool suppliers, although all ready-mix suppliers will test ... philippine coast guard online applicationWebApr 20, 2024 · If porcelain, it’s best practice to use a non-permeable pointing material. This is because there is a slim chance of porcelain paving—which has very low porosity—popping from the mortar bed. This is caused by moisture migrating between the paving and the mortar bed and then freezing and expanding in the winter. truma water heater rvWebDec 10, 2024 · Flags should be supported on a full ‘wet’ workable mix mortar bed (1:4 cement/sharp sand), you should lay the mortar bedding to give a thickness between … philippine coast guard northern luzonWebMay 19, 2024 · You can get the polymeric resin mortars in two different consistencies – one is thinned with water so that it flows out of a brush, and this is ideal for applying around small joints in paving bricks; the other is thicker and ideal for larger joints.
